    3. First I want to thank those who offered assistance and suggestions in my search ... and particularly Elly Smith whose suggestion has come up trumps. I just received the birth certificate for Charles and Elizabeth's son Lewis LEWIS and at the time of his birth in 1878 they were living at the same address as they were in the 1881 census which reassures me that I have the right person. Better still, his parents are recorded as Isaac LEWIS and Elizabeth née EMANUEL. This confirms that Charles and Isaac are the same person. Goodness knows why he and Elizabeth/Beysey have to keep changing their names on all these records - didn't they think of the confusion it would cause me later! Thank goodness they left this one piece of evidence that links their identities together. Now that quandry is behind me, I just have to identify Charles/Isaac's parents. As I think I mentioned before his father was recorded as Levy LEWIS on his marriage certificate, but no such person seems to exist, at least not of an age that could have fathered Charles/Isaac in 1845. With the family rumour that he changed his name from Levy, it seems my best bet is to assume he started life as Isaac LEVY and perhaps record his father's name that way to somehow reflect the name change. Any suggestions as to how I might go about finding his parents will be very grateful received. Steve
